    After undergoing septoplasty in Quebec City, it's common to experience some nasal congestion as your body heals. Here are some tips to help clear your nose during this recovery period:

    1. Use Saline Nasal Spray: Saline sprays can help moisten the nasal passages and reduce congestion. They are gentle and can be used multiple times a day.

    2. Elevate Your Head: Sleeping with your head elevated can help reduce swelling and make breathing easier. Use extra pillows to keep your head higher than your body.

    3. Avoid Sudden Movements: Sudden movements or bending over can increase nasal pressure and cause discomfort. Take it slow and avoid strenuous activities.

    4. Follow Your Doctor's Instructions: It's crucial to follow any specific post-operative care instructions provided by your surgeon. This may include medications or specific cleaning routines.

    5. Stay Hydrated: Drinking plenty of fluids can help thin mucus and make it easier to clear your nose. Water is particularly beneficial.

    6. Use a Humidifier: A humidifier can add moisture to the air, which can help alleviate nasal dryness and congestion.

    7. Avoid Irritants: Stay away from smoke, strong odors, and other irritants that can exacerbate nasal discomfort.

    8. Monitor for Complications: Keep an eye out for signs of infection or other complications, such as excessive bleeding or severe pain, and contact your doctor if you notice anything unusual.

    By following these guidelines, you can help ensure a smoother recovery and clearer breathing after your septoplasty in Quebec City. Always consult with your healthcare provider for personalized advice.

    After undergoing septoplasty in Quebec City, it's crucial to follow a proper post-operative care routine to ensure optimal healing and reduce the risk of complications. One of the most effective ways to manage nasal congestion and promote clear breathing is through the use of a saline nasal spray. This gentle solution can be used several times a day to keep the nasal passages moist and free of debris, which is particularly beneficial in the early stages of recovery.

    Understanding the Importance of Saline Nasal Spray

    Saline nasal sprays are non-medicated solutions that help to cleanse the nasal cavity by flushing out mucus, allergens, and other irritants. They are particularly useful after septoplasty because they provide a soothing effect without causing irritation or interfering with the healing process. Regular use of a saline nasal spray can significantly reduce the discomfort associated with nasal congestion and help you breathe more easily.

    Additional Tips for Post-Septoplasty Care

    In addition to using a saline nasal spray, there are other measures you can take to facilitate healing and reduce nasal congestion:

    • Avoid Strenuous Activities: Refrain from heavy lifting or vigorous exercise for at least two weeks post-surgery to prevent increased blood flow to the nose, which can cause swelling and bleeding.
    • Use Humidifiers: Keeping the air moist can help alleviate dryness and irritation in the nasal passages.
    • Follow Medication Instructions: Take any prescribed medications as directed by your surgeon to manage pain and prevent infection.
    • Attend Follow-Up Appointments: Regular check-ups with your surgeon are essential to monitor your recovery and address any concerns promptly.

    Understanding Nasal Congestion Post-Septoplasty

    Nasal congestion is a common concern following septoplasty, a surgical procedure aimed at correcting a deviated septum. In Quebec City, where healthcare standards are high, it's essential to understand the natural course of recovery and the steps you can take to alleviate congestion.

    Post-Operative Care and Congestion Management

    Immediately after your septoplasty, you may experience significant nasal congestion due to swelling and the presence of internal dressings. This is a normal part of the healing process. Here are some professional tips to help you manage this discomfort:

    1. Use Saline Nasal Sprays: These can help keep the nasal passages moist and reduce congestion. Be sure to use a saline solution recommended by your healthcare provider.

    2. Elevate Your Head: Sleeping with your head elevated can reduce swelling and help alleviate congestion. Use extra pillows to maintain this position.

    3. Avoid Irritants: Stay away from smoke, dust, and other irritants that can exacerbate nasal congestion. This is crucial for a smooth recovery.

    4. Follow Medication Instructions: Your doctor will prescribe medications to manage pain and reduce swelling. Ensure you take these as directed to support your recovery.

    When to Seek Medical Attention

    While nasal congestion is expected, there are instances where you should seek immediate medical attention:

    • Persistent Pain: If the pain is not managed by prescribed medications, consult your doctor.
    • Excessive Bleeding: Any significant bleeding should be reported to your healthcare provider.
    • Fever: A fever could indicate an infection, which requires prompt medical attention.

    Long-Term Congestion Considerations

    In some cases, patients may experience lingering congestion even after the initial healing period. This could be due to residual swelling or other factors. If you find that your congestion persists beyond the expected recovery time, it's important to schedule a follow-up appointment with your surgeon. They can assess the situation and recommend further treatments if necessary.
